Hamilton, Rosberg welcome sound of silence
Lewis Hamilton and Nico Rosberg on Thursday welcomed the sound of radio silence for the final six races of their dramatic duel for the drivers' world championship. But the airwave clampdown was criticised by Felipe Massa, the veteran Williams driver warning ahead of Sunday's Singapore Grand Prix that it could lead to a major accident. Mercedes teammates Hamilton and Rosberg, who have fought an intense and sometimes acrimonious battle this year, will, like the rest of the pitlane, no longer have unrestricted radio contact with their teams.
